Repairing or Replacing Worn-Out Parts of a Leather Jacket

To repair or replace worn-out parts of a leather jacket, the alteration service will typically use various techniques to restore the jacket to its original condition. This may include:

  • Re-stitching or re-sewing worn-out seams or holes.
  • Re-finishing or re-dyeing the leather to restore its original color and texture.
  • Replacing damaged or worn-out components, such as zippers or buttons.
  • Sculpting or re-working the leather to restore its original shape or contours.

Choosing the Right Type of Leather for Alteration, Leather jacket alterations near me

When choosing a leather jacket for alteration, consider the type of leather used in the garment. Different types of leather have varying degrees of durability and versatility, making some more suitable for alterations than others. Common types of leather include:

  1. Mild cowhide leather: A popular choice for jackets, mild cowhide leather is durable and versatile, suitable for a wide range of alterations.
  2. Full-grain leather: High-quality, full-grain leather is ideal for jackets that require precise shaping and detailing.
  3. Pigskin leather: Strong and durable, pigskin leather is often used for jacket cuffs and collars.
  4. Vegetable-tanned leather: A more delicate option, vegetable-tanned leather requires special care and handling during alteration.

Factors to Consider When Pricing Alteration Services

When it comes to pricing alteration services for a leather jacket, there are several factors to consider. Getting the price right can make or break your business, so it’s essential to understand what customers are looking for. In this section, we’ll break down the key considerations to ensure you’re competitive and transparent in your pricing.

When determining the price of an alteration service, it’s essential to consider the quality of materials and labor costs. The cost of materials can vary greatly depending on the type and quality of leather used in the jacket. For example, top-grain leather can be more expensive than bonded leather. Similarly, the cost of labor can vary depending on the complexity of the alteration and the expertise of the tailor.

Comparing Pricing of Local Alteration Services

To ensure you’re competitive, it’s essential to compare the pricing of local alteration services. Here’s a table to help you get started:

Alteration Service Price Range (per hour)
Simple alterations (e.g., hemming pants) £20-£50
Moderate alterations (e.g., taking in a jacket) £30-£70
Complex alterations (e.g., bespoke leather work) £50-£100+

Maintaining and Extending the Life of Altered Leather Jackets

Maintaining an altered leather jacket is all about showing your gear some love and care. Just like how you sort out your mates, taking care of your leather jacket means it’ll be by your side for the long haul. Regularly cleaning and conditioning your leather will keep it looking fresh and prevent it from drying out.

The Importance of Cleaning

Cleaning is an essential part of maintaining your leather jacket’s health. Regular cleaning removes dirt, oils, and grime that can seep into the leather and cause damage over time. It’s like giving your jacket a wash, mate – you don’t want any stains or imperfections ruining the look.

When cleaning your leather jacket:

– Use a gentle leather cleaner, specifically designed for the type of leather your jacket is made of (aniline, semi-aniline, pigmented, etc.)
–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as they can damage the leather
– Don’t over-saturate the leather, as excess moisture can lead to mold or mildew growth
– Gently pat the leather dry with a soft cloth

Conditioning and Protecting

Conditioning your leather jacket is like giving it a moisturizer treatment. It keeps the leather supple and protected from dryness, which can cause it to crack or become brittle. Think of it like how you keep your skin hydrated – your leather jacket needs it too.

To condition your leather jacket:

– Use a high-quality leather conditioner, specifically designed for the type of leather your jacket is made of
– Apply the conditioner evenly, following the manufacturer’s instructions
– Let the conditioner soak in for a few minutes before buffing it out with a soft cloth
– Repeat the process every 6-12 months, depending on how often you use and wear your jacket

Proper Storage and Handling

Proper storage and handling are crucial for extending the life of your leather jacket. Think of it like how you handle a fragile vase – care and attention are key to keeping it in one piece.

When storing your leather jacket:

– Hang it on a wide, padded hanger to maintain its shape and prevent creasing
– Store it in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and moisture
– Avoid folding or packing it tightly, as this can cause creases and damage
– Consider using a garment bag or storage bag to protect it from dust and debris
